HUNTERS NEED TO REPORT ON TAGS PURCHASED

January 11, 2020 10:00 a.m.

Big game and turkey hunters should report their tags online or at a license sale agent to avoid long waits on the phone.

A release from the Oregon Department of Fish and Wildlife said the deadline to report most tags and avoid any penalties is the end of January.

The release said hunters need to report on every deer, elk, bear, cougar, turkey and pronghorn sheep tag purchased or issued as part of a Sports Pac license, even if they didn’t harvest an animal or go hunting.

To use ODFW’s online licensing system, go to https://odfw.huntfishoregon.com/login

Hunters who fail to report a deer or elk tag by the deadline will be charged a $25 penalty. The fine will have to be paid in order to purchase a 2022 or future hunting license.
